(CRN 61371)  Exploring Alternative & Traditional Health Modalities

Come and explore a variety of effective healing modalities, and learn how to make more informed decisions about your health. Through illustrated lecture and discussion, you’ll find out why interest in alternative and traditional health and healing methods are at an all-time high, and have the option of participating in several safe, experiential demonstrations of each modality. We’ll discuss Aromatherapy, Chinese Medicine, Flower Essences, Guided Imagery, Herbalism, Homeopathy, Massage, Meditation and Shamanism.

(CRN 61372)  Herbs for Massage

Community members and Licensed Massage Therapists are welcome to attend this class to learn how useful herbs are for massage. Discover how to make an herbal healing massage oil and a soothing herbal massage lotion. You will also get a review of anatomy, physiology, and pathology related to massage, and find out how to use herbs for health and healing. This course provides six continuing education hours for Licensed Massage Therapists.
